Just did the mod to my 1100S, I cut everything off to just leave the rings. Awesome balance of sound now, still loud but not too loud. I have a cheap db meter on my phone and it dropped the decibels by about 6 or 7. Like I say it is a cheap app so take it for what it is worth, however the sound is great. I kept taking the baffles out and then putting them back in, now it seems perfect.

I have a 2011 796 with termi carbons. The DB killers did not have an open end. Like everyone else bike was way too quiet with db killers in and too loud with them out. I tried the whole ear plug thing and couldn't deal with it. Instead of modding the Termi db killers I ordered the DB killers in 47.5mm size from Desmoworld. After a week of nothing, I was delighted when I got a response back. A very helpful employee named Tina (I believe) processed the order. Cost me a little less than $50 shipped from Germany to CT and took about a week. The Desmoworld DB killers are a perfect balance, loud enough and I do not need to wear ear plugs. This also allowed me to save the stock termi db killers in case I ever sell the bike or pipes. The sound is very similar to my former bike (2006 S2R1K) which had Arrow pipes on with no baffles. I still can't believe how much louder the Termi's are than the Arrow's with no baffles. Strange. In any case I am very happy that I found a solution. Best $50 I have spent in a while!
